About the role

As a Videographer/Editor at Nomadic UK, you will play a key role in creating captivating, on-brand videos that consistently exceed client expectations.

Responsibilities

  • Film diverse content, ranging from interviews to b-roll and cinematic footage.
  • Organize and curate raw footage (“rushes”) for effective editing.
  • Craft compelling video content by seamlessly weaving camera footage, audio, and animated text overlays.
  • Collaborate closely with the creative director to ensure the realization of desired visual outcomes.
  • Efficiently manage multiple editing projects concurrently, adhering to deadlines.
  • Skillfully integrate feedback from clients and colleagues in a timely and professional manner.
  • Contribute to tasks such as media management, audio editing, color grading, and final delivery.

Requirements

  • Proficiency with Mirrorless and Cinema Cameras, both handheld and on a gimbal.
  • Ability to achieve optimal exposure, framing, and focusing in shots.
  • Experience in lighting scenes and conducting interviews.
  • Mastery of DaVinci Resolve, Adobe After Effects, and Adobe Premiere Pro.
  • Either a degree in Video Production/Editing or 3-4 years of industry experience.
  • Strong technical and organizational editing skills, encompassing media management, color grading, and delivery.
  • Capability to conceptualize visually creative ideas based on initial project briefs.
  • Demonstrated track record of consistently delivering high-quality video edits.
  • Exceptional attention to detail and a discerning eye for visual aesthetics.
